Police Announce Capture of Brikman Stabber, Skepticism Persists

Hundreds of concerned resident of Crown Heights turned out to attend an “update meeting” with the NYPD following the arrest of the person they believe responsible for the stabbing of 25-year-old Yehuda Leib Brikman.

“I am here to announce that we have some good news with regards to that” said Chief Steven Powers, describing the two stabbings and robbery in and near Prospect Park by an individual who police believe is also responsible for the vicious and unprovoked attack on Leiby Brikman.

The suspect, who was identified as 26-year-old Keny Rochelin, was later spotted by two anti-crime officers from the 70th Precinct and was taken into custody. The two victims then positively identified Rochelin as the man who attacked them.

“Due to the fine work of the detectives involved someone noted the similarities between the perpetrator and the numerous video we have from the prior assault in Crown Heights, we were able to positive identify the guy as the perpetrator of those attacks.

“Hate crimes task force responded to the precinct and was able to put together a case on this individual, and based upon a series of post arrest techniques Mr. Rochelin is being charged with attempted murder in the second degree as a hate crime, criminal possession of a weapon and aggravated harassment in the assault on Mr. Brikman.

“Some may ask are we sure we got the right guy? Well, due to a series of investigative techniques and obtaining a search warrant for the individual’s residents, we were able to come up with the clothing that he was wearing on the day that he assaulted Mr. Brikman. So we are pretty sure we got the right guy” said Chief Powers.

Many expressed doubt that Mr. Rochelin is in fact the person who stabbed Leiby Brikman and some called the timing of the arrest into question as well. Mrs. Brikman voiced that concern before the crowd, demanding that police follow up with her to assure her that the person in question is in fact that attacker.

“Many have asked me ‘are you happy that he has finally been caught?’ if they in fact did, I am really happy. But I saw this with a heavy heart but we had many questions about the timing – this is not g-d forbid an attack – but I have to ask for the safety of the Crown Heights community, I am demanding a follow up confirming this is the guy and the DNA on the knife is still pending” said Mrs. Brikman.

“And in yesterday’s stabbing there was a robbery, but my son was stabbed because he is a Jew and nothing else, so is this really the same person?” she asked.

Chief Powers responded that they are confident that the person in custody is the man who committed all three stabbings. “We have his clothing that he was wearing on the day of the attack and I believe we got a very prosecutable and winnable case.”

Mrs. Brikman thanked the community for their support, “thank you treating my son like your son because it could have happened to anyone.”
